#128d14 h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#128d14 is composed of 7.1% red, 55.3%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 85.8%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 121 degrees, a saturation of 77.4% and a lightness of 31.2%. #128d14 color hex could be obtained by blending #24ff28 with #001b00. Closest websafe color is: #009900.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000200 is the darkest color, while #effdf0 is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4f504f is the less saturated color, while #069908 is the most saturated one.
